What is the average salary in Woods Cross, UT?

The average salary in Woods Cross, UT is $56,963 per year.

Woods Cross, UT, offers a range of salary opportunities for job seekers. The average yearly salary in the area is $56,963. This figure provides a good benchmark for understanding the earning potential in the region.


The salary distribution shows a variety of income levels. The most common salary range is between $33,864 and $43,727. This range covers a significant portion of the workforce, with 26.52% of employees earning within this bracket. Other notable salary ranges include $24,000 to $33,864 and $43,727 to $53,591. These figures highlight the diversity in earnings across different job sectors in Woods Cross.

How does the cost of living in Woods Cross, UT compare to the national average?

The cost of living in Woods Cross, UT, exceeds the nationwide average by 15%. This increase is primarily due to higher housing costs, which are 20% above the national average. Other expenses, such as utilities and transportation, are also slightly higher, contributing to the overall elevated cost of living.
